Sebastien Bourdeauducq
|
3392cecee1
|
tec_p should only be negative
|
2023-09-13 16:03:54 +08:00 |
Sebastien Bourdeauducq
|
c9c43f9f14
|
consistent naming
|
2023-09-13 16:03:40 +08:00 |
Sebastien Bourdeauducq
|
90ea4c599f
|
reduce dropped frames
|
2023-09-13 16:01:46 +08:00 |
Sebastien Bourdeauducq
|
6f12fe7ed5
|
GUI fixes
|
2023-09-13 15:57:50 +08:00 |
Sebastien Bourdeauducq
|
9690d8f611
|
locking parameters
|
2023-09-13 15:50:46 +08:00 |
Sebastien Bourdeauducq
|
1e84520a5f
|
populate lineshape display
|
2023-09-13 14:40:18 +08:00 |
Sebastien Bourdeauducq
|
17cd2f28da
|
use bladeRF async API
|
2023-09-13 14:31:19 +08:00 |
Sebastien Bourdeauducq
|
bd85526290
|
dual wf display
|
2023-09-13 11:14:14 +08:00 |
Sebastien Bourdeauducq
|
9bee53ab49
|
minor cleanup, use const
|
2023-09-13 10:46:40 +08:00 |
Sebastien Bourdeauducq
|
52bbfc0c33
|
factor out FFT
|
2023-09-13 10:40:07 +08:00 |
Sebastien Bourdeauducq
|
9e842ddad5
|
use sinara thermostat, minor gui improvements
|
2023-09-12 10:11:46 +08:00 |
Sebastien Bourdeauducq
|
57d41479b3
|
display control loop ticks on waterfall
|
2023-09-11 20:40:47 +08:00 |
Sebastien Bourdeauducq
|
747c7d2e38
|
fix tec voltage computation
|
2023-09-11 20:40:28 +08:00 |
Sebastien Bourdeauducq
|
1f783793db
|
center freq
|
2023-09-11 20:39:47 +08:00 |
Sebastien Bourdeauducq
|
dd370499f8
|
TEC control loop
|
2023-09-11 20:00:48 +08:00 |
Sebastien Bourdeauducq
|
1b363e7de9
|
control Rigol PSU
|
2023-09-11 19:20:51 +08:00 |
Sebastien Bourdeauducq
|
5b8f284a41
|
optimize FFT
|
2023-09-11 19:20:20 +08:00 |
Sebastien Bourdeauducq
|
49d0fa5130
|
add update button
|
2023-09-07 21:26:26 +08:00 |
Sebastien Bourdeauducq
|
03e46f97eb
|
fix fft, display and hw settings
|
2023-09-07 21:00:22 +08:00 |
Sebastien Bourdeauducq
|
fcd5d64053
|
update dependencies
|
2023-09-07 20:58:22 +08:00 |
Sebastien Bourdeauducq
|
9eb13ee140
|
use bladeRF
|
2023-09-07 20:17:02 +08:00 |
Sebastien Bourdeauducq
|
7fced717e6
|
rename from microsa
|
2023-09-07 19:15:07 +08:00 |
Sebastien Bourdeauducq
|
1530372180
|
actually use pulseaudio (works around several ALSA bugs/problems)
|
2023-08-24 00:14:37 +08:00 |
Sebastien Bourdeauducq
|
020469d1a2
|
display spectrum
|
2023-08-23 21:29:42 +08:00 |
Sebastien Bourdeauducq
|
f28c0965ec
|
add pocketfft
|
2023-08-23 19:57:01 +08:00 |
Sebastien Bourdeauducq
|
b184b71169
|
simplify devShell
|
2023-08-23 19:56:50 +08:00 |
Sebastien Bourdeauducq
|
89cb0383e5
|
remove old comment
|
2023-08-23 19:52:34 +08:00 |
Sebastien Bourdeauducq
|
b9b80c0ecb
|
switch to alsalib
|
2023-08-23 19:46:36 +08:00 |
Sebastien Bourdeauducq
|
715b461a46
|
tinyalsa attempt
|
2023-08-23 18:44:27 +08:00 |
Sebastien Bourdeauducq
|
9c47f72298
|
generate data in thread
|
2023-08-23 15:53:50 +08:00 |
Sebastien Bourdeauducq
|
26af4416c2
|
use atexit
|
2023-08-23 15:06:05 +08:00 |
Sebastien Bourdeauducq
|
fb2bafb215
|
image display, two columns
|
2023-08-23 13:12:28 +08:00 |
Sebastien Bourdeauducq
|
afa0145241
|
packaging
|
2023-08-23 11:08:54 +08:00 |
Sebastien Bourdeauducq
|
36dc98f776
|
imgui init
|
2023-08-22 23:41:16 +08:00 |
Sebastien Bourdeauducq
|
1c7bb39121
|
imgui compilation
|
2023-08-22 23:24:17 +08:00 |